We compared two Desktop platform GPUs: 1024MB VRAM GeForce GT 720 OEM and 1024MB VRAM GeForce GTX 465 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ce GT 720 OEM 's Advantages
Released 7 years and 5 months late
Lower TDP (50W vs 200W)
NVIDIA GeForce GTX 465 's Advantages
Larger VRAM bandwidth (102.7GB/s vs 28.51GB/s)
160 additional rendering cores
